Date range picker: Display date less than or equal to the selected date

I am using the Qlik Sense Date Range Picker extension.

I decided to use only the "Single Date" option because my goal is to leave the choice to the user to select a date and that in my table the date less than or equal to the date selected in the date range picker displayed.

Example: If the user selects 24/01/2020 in the Date Range Picker, then the dates from 01/01/2020 to 240/01/2020 should be displayed.
That is to say all the dates before or equal to 24/01/2020 must appear in my table.


Knowing that in my measure I do this:

sum({$< Flag_Fait={'F_TAXES'},[DATE FOR GL]={"<=$(=max([DATE FOR GL]))"},YEAR=>}[AMOUNT GROSS])


However when I select a date in the calendar I only have the selected date displayed and not the lower dates.

It sounds like you would like to select one date 24/01/2020 and return all dates to the beginning of the year. You probably want to do set analysis like this https://community.qlik.com/t5/QlikView-App-Development/Set-analysis-Filter-for-all-dates-prior-to-cu.... You can also add a YTD (year-to-date) field to your calendar and use it in your selection box.
